Electrical, Electronic, and Electromechanical Assemblers, Except Coil Winders, Tapers, and Finishers Salary in Provo-Orem-Lehi, UT
In Provo-Orem-Lehi, UT, electrical, electronic, and electromechanical assemblers, except coil winders, tapers, and finishers earn $35,510 at the median, or about $17.07 an hour. The range runs from $26K at the entry level to $51K for experienced workers. Adjusted for local prices (RPP 98.23), that's roughly $36,150 in purchasing power. A 2-bedroom apartment runs $1,460/month — about 60.3% of take-home, which is tight.

Frequently asked questions
How much do electrical, electronic, and electromechanical assemblers, except coil winders, tapers, and finishers make in Provo-Orem-Lehi, UT?
The median is $35,510 a year, that works out to about $17 an hour. But the range is wide: entry-level workers start around $26,000, and experienced electrical, electronic, and electromechanical assemblers, except coil winders, tapers, and finishers can clear $51,370. These are BLS numbers, based on employer-reported data, not self-reported surveys.
Is $36K enough to live in Provo-Orem-Lehi?
On that salary, you'd take home roughly $2,410/month after taxes. A 2-bedroom here rents for about $1,460/month, which eats 60.6% of your paycheck. That's above the 30% rule of thumb, housing will be a stretch at the median salary, though you can manage with roommates or a smaller place.
How far does a electrical, electronic, and electromechanical assemblers, except coil winders, tapers, and finishers salary go in Provo-Orem-Lehi?
Provo-Orem-Lehi has a Regional Price Parity of 98.23 (100 is the national average). That's below average, your money stretches further here than the raw salary number suggests. After cost-of-living adjustment, the median electrical, electronic, and electromechanical assemblers, except coil winders, tapers, and finishers salary is worth about $36,150 in national-average purchasing power.
